| package org.apache.qpid.bytebuffer; |
| |
| import java.util.Collection; |
| import java.util.Iterator; |
| |
| import junit.framework.TestCase; |
| import org.junit.Assert; |
| |
| public class QpidByteBufferOutputStreamTest extends TestCase |
| { |
| public void testWriteByteByByte() throws Exception |
| { |
| boolean direct = false; |
| QpidByteBufferOutputStream stream = new QpidByteBufferOutputStream(direct, 3); |
| stream.write('a'); |
| stream.write('b'); |
| |
| Collection<QpidByteBuffer> bufs = stream.fetchAccumulatedBuffers(); |
| assertEquals("Unexpected number of buffers", 2, bufs.size()); |
| Iterator<QpidByteBuffer> bufItr = bufs.iterator(); |
| |
| QpidByteBuffer buf1 = bufItr.next(); |
| assertBufferContent("1st buffer", buf1, "a".getBytes(), direct); |
| |
| |
| QpidByteBuffer buf2 = bufItr.next(); |
| assertBufferContent("2nd buffer", buf2, "b".getBytes(), direct); |
| } |
| |
| public void testWriteByteArrays() throws Exception |
| { |
| boolean direct = false; |
| QpidByteBufferOutputStream stream = new QpidByteBufferOutputStream(direct, 8); |
| stream.write("abcd".getBytes(), 0, 4); |
| stream.write("_ef_".getBytes(), 1, 2); |
| |
| Collection<QpidByteBuffer> bufs = stream.fetchAccumulatedBuffers(); |
| assertEquals("Unexpected number of buffers", 2, bufs.size()); |
| Iterator<QpidByteBuffer> bufItr = bufs.iterator(); |
| |
| QpidByteBuffer buf1 = bufItr.next(); |
| assertBufferContent("1st buffer", buf1, "abcd".getBytes(), direct); |
| |
| QpidByteBuffer buf2 = bufItr.next(); |
| assertBufferContent("2nd buffer", buf2, "ef".getBytes(), direct); |
| } |
| |
| public void testWriteMixed() throws Exception |
| { |
| boolean direct = true; |
| QpidByteBufferOutputStream stream = new QpidByteBufferOutputStream(direct, 3); |
| stream.write('a'); |
| stream.write("bcd".getBytes()); |
| |
| Collection<QpidByteBuffer> bufs = stream.fetchAccumulatedBuffers(); |
| assertEquals("Unexpected number of buffers", 2, bufs.size()); |
| Iterator<QpidByteBuffer> bufItr = bufs.iterator(); |
| |
| QpidByteBuffer buf1 = bufItr.next(); |
| assertBufferContent("1st buffer", buf1, "a".getBytes(), direct); |
| |
| QpidByteBuffer buf2 = bufItr.next(); |
| assertBufferContent("2nd buffer", buf2, "bcd".getBytes(), direct); |
| } |
| |
| |
| public void testWriteByteArrays_ArrayTooLargeForSingleBuffer() throws Exception |
| { |
| boolean direct = false; |
| QpidByteBufferOutputStream stream = new QpidByteBufferOutputStream(direct, 8); |
| stream.write("abcdefghi".getBytes()); |
| |
| Collection<QpidByteBuffer> bufs = stream.fetchAccumulatedBuffers(); |
| assertEquals("Unexpected number of buffers", 2, bufs.size()); |
| Iterator<QpidByteBuffer> bufItr = bufs.iterator(); |
| |
| QpidByteBuffer buf1 = bufItr.next(); |
| assertBufferContent("1st buffer", buf1, "abcdefgh".getBytes(), direct); |
| |
| QpidByteBuffer buf2 = bufItr.next(); |
| assertBufferContent("2nd buffer", buf2, "i".getBytes(), direct); |
| } |
| |
| private void assertBufferContent(String bufName, QpidByteBuffer buf, byte[] expectedBytes, final boolean direct) |
| { |
| assertEquals(bufName + " has unexpected number of bytes", expectedBytes.length, buf.remaining()); |
| byte[] copy = new byte[buf.remaining()]; |
| buf.get(copy); |
| Assert.assertArrayEquals(bufName + " has unexpected content", expectedBytes, copy); |
| assertEquals(bufName + " has unexpected type", direct, buf.isDirect()); |
| } |
| |
| } |
